Firing directly straight up will rob the bullet of it's velocity even though it will be still be rotating at many tens of thousands of RPMs when it comes back down.

A bullet fired at a 45-degree angle will certainly be lethal. I've seen a hole in a fender of a truck caused by celebratory shooting that came down at about a 60 degree angle. It was a .30 rifle round of some kind and was probably fired from well over a mile away.
